* Coded Edited with Fix * I found an open source project that has a few bugs (I have fixed a couple so far) but this one has me stumped. The issue that I am trying to solve… If I have 3 sets of pairs (isThreePair) and it is also a 4 of a Kind (example: 4ea – 3’s and 2ea 4’s) it always chooses the 4 of a kind (isFourOfAKind), I should be able to pick either. Can someone please tell me what is wrong with the code.

    Walk through the code and think what would happen if it was four of a kind.

                    int fourOfAKindStatus = 0;
                    if (length == 4)
                            fourOfAKindStatus = isFourOfAKind(newArray, c, length)[0];
                    if (fourOfAKindStatus > 0)
                            return fourOfAKindStatus;
    
                    int threeOfAKindStatus = 0;
                    if (length == 3)
                            threeOfAKindStatus = isThreeOfAKind(newArray, c, length)[0];
                    if (threeOfAKindStatus > 0)
                            return threeOfAKindStatus;
    

    If the result is four of a kind, you are returning from the method before checking for 3 of a kind. Therefore, the three of a kind check never gets performed.

    You could have calculate() return a HashMap instead of an int, and instead of immediately returning the status when you find a match, you could add an entry to the map and keep checking, returning it at the end.
